On a cold 14-degree morning in the Shenandoah Valley, it was warm inside the Augusta County Library in Fishersville as local business people stopped by for breakfast and business with the Greater Augusta Region Chamber of Commerce.
Library Director Diantha McCauley, with the help of staff and Augusta Economic Director Amanda Glover, had prepared a PowerPoint presentation highlighting tools offered by the library that could be helpful to businesses.
Library board members Kurt Michael and Lynn Mitchell as well as Supervisor Marshall Pattie, who is Board of Supervisors liaison, attended.
